>I still have CentOS7 running with the latest Samba Version available 
>for it (samba-4.10.16-20.el7)
>I'm experiencing a really strange issue. When I copy a file larger 
>than 2GB I  always get a network
>drop. It just stops at around 1,74gb. The logs didn't show something 
>in default logging level and
>are overwhelming at 5. An interesting detail is: If I pause the copy 
>process every other second
>I can get the whole file copied. If I let it run at full speed it is 
>not working. Any idea? I already
>played around with socket options and stuff. No change. The shares is 
>located on a xfs formatted drive.

Might be:

https://bugzilla.samba.org/show_bug.cgi?id=15261

Contains a patch you might try.
